Attorneys Will Rieser, Esq. and Brian C. Farrell, Esq. recently secured a $625,000.01 verdict against Boulevard Autogroup, LLC on behalf of their client, Michael Burgo, in the U.S. District Court for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ania (case No. 23-3187). Boulevard Autogroup, LLC rehired Dealership Manager Michael Burgo, then 67 years old, in 2018. A Lower Court Ruling Has Been Overturned, Clearing Path for Lawsuit The U.S. Court of Appeals for the Third Circuit has cleared the way for a religious bias lawsuit against Philadelphia District Attorney Larry Krasner. The decision overturned a lower court ruling that former Assistant District Attorney Rachel Spivack failed to provide evidence demonstrating that Krasner showed hostility toward her religion when she refused to comply with a COVID-19 vaccine requirement on religious grounds. Principal Shareholder Sidney L. Gold, Esq. has filed a discrimination lawsuit against Kutztown University on behalf of his client, Janet Malouf. Malouf is the head of the women’s basketball team. The lawsuit was filed in the United States District Court for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ania on June 05, 2024.
